Today we’d like to introduce you to Xavier Nixon.
Xavier, please share your story with us. How did you get to where you are today?
Man, I started back in 2015 after promoting parties for HTS which was owned by Romeo Gabbana and throwing kickbacks with my TeamGutz bros. I found my self trying to figure out what I wanted to do with my life what was next truth be told I had no idea what I wanted to do I just knew I wanted to get money and be secure in life. One day I was having a normal life conversation with my brother SirJoe he shoots videos and is apart of the BlackMRKTMovement now, he asked me what I wanted to do. I told him I didn’t know, he said you like music don’t you and I was like yea I do but I’m not a rapper then I told him me and my two homegirls were talking about starting a label he told me to go for it. I was like bet might as well because something that’s always stuck with me when it came to making the decision of which route to take in life was my mama telling me that whatever I choose to do in life make sure it’s my passion so I can wake up loving what I do. Man that shit was hard because in all honesty man I’ve never had a passion for anything, I call myself trying different things growing up but nothing ever stuck. I played football quit that shit after 10th or 11th grade I never understood how niggas was so hyped behind that shit lol, don’t get me wrong I love football sports in general, I even attempted to make beats in high school never knew why that didn’t stick.
I use to sit on the computer just playing around I want to say I used FL Studio fruity loops whatever it’s called lol, man. I even auditioned for Disney channel in high school not many people know that I remember after the interview I made it to the part where’s they start asking for money completely killed my hope and dreams lol. I was like damn y’all couldn’t let me know it was gone cost to get through before I spent a week practicing in the mirror like an ass lol, but man yea back to the story so then I went back and chopped it up with my homegirls we were music junkies and each had a passion but didn’t know how to get where we wanted, so boom I started doing my research then just started free styling and got in the field. I feel like the best way to start doing what you want do in life is to just start doing it, if that makes sense man I totally emerged myself in everything music business from books to YouTube videos really trying to gain the knowledge. I’ve worked with several artist along the way they all taught me valuable lessons that are relevant till this day then I started networking and going to open mics and shows, that’s when I really started to learn the game.
We’re always bombarded by how great it is to pursue your passion, etc – but we’ve spoken with enough people to know that it’s not always easy. Overall, would you say things have been easy for you?
Not at all man with anything you do there will be obstacles the objective is to overcome them, more importantly how you overcome them, what do you do when faced with adversity. I’ve never been a quitter when I really really really want something I do everything in my power to accomplish set goal or die trying haha. Life itself will test you it’s been a journey trying to be consistent and make it in the music industry. I was homeless a couple of times that definitely slowed down progression, you can’t run a business with no funds I learned haha. But losing friends you do business with is probably the hardest, the people I started this whole thing with aren’t here anymore doing this by myself has been a struggle but the reward is worth it in the end.
We’d love to hear more about your business.
My company is technically called Unorthodox Records, we specialize in empowering the artist we want to be a direct bridge from artist to mainstream success. I’m probably known for working with artist like Lonersclub and Brionne. I’m not sure how aware people are of me yet lol I try to move silent & strategic, man the thing I’m most proud of is the unveiling of my company by the time this interview is published we should be rolling out the business with our first show. What sets me apart, hmm good question I think what sets me apart is I try to let the work speak before you even see me I don’t feel the need to be in the camera or center of attention my business should have your attention not me.
